Output f6ab255cbf0ec6b3f75f1e358520ac95d8a48e3ea4cc53a58d55d2a27a798185:2

value
4361411998
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 38d2e8fb484203e5bdaea47c677477f8fcefbf6740a49ae1dbf67623acd8e703
address
tb1p8rfw376gggp7t0dw537xwarhlr7wl0m8gzjf4cwm7emz8txcuupshqcxdx
transaction
f6ab255cbf0ec6b3f75f1e358520ac95d8a48e3ea4cc53a58d55d2a27a798185
confirmations
73256
spent
true